Hand dyed Shibori Purse

First to recommend

Description

This lovely handbag was createdby Auntie Uclid's Random Emporium.

Per the artist's description:
"Not only is this purse one-of-a-kind, the individual pieces of fabric are one-of-a-kind as well. Starting with plain white fabric such as muslin or recycled sheets, the fabric is hand-dyed using traditional Japanese shibori techniques, folding and stitching the fabric between dyebaths to create interesting patterns.

This particular purse measures 10"x8"x3.5" with a short strap perfect for city use. It is lined with a solid black broadcloth. The whole purse has been stiffened with interfacing, and the body of the purse is sewn together with a special 3-in-1 stitch for extra strength." (via 1000 Markets)

Pagoda II

First to recommend

Description

This earthy and intriguing pendant was created by artist, MannyBeads.

Per the artist's description:
"These Pagoda pendants just seemed to come about one morning...Pagoda structures are know to Eastern culture and landscape and the first record of the pagoda is in the 3rd century, Nepal. They were used to both house and make available sacred Buddhist relics and writings. So for me, I like to think that this bone and stone Pagoda might serve to hold for you a symbolic reminder of that which is sacred...words, ideas, believes, gratitude, lessons.

This unisex Pagoda is a simple pairing of etched bone above and natural turquoise below. It is strung on 1/2" waxed cotton cord that is a total length of 26" and the pendant adds 1.75", not including the cord ends below the bottom stone. The natural turquoise stone that anchors the Pagoda at the bottom is 24mm x 7mm." (via 1000 Markets)
